Q1. What is the minimum or maximum age to start piano lesson?
A.1 I have taken from 4 years old to 78 years old students. Anyone who wants to play the piano is welcome. However, kids need to sit still and communicate.

Q.2 Do we need to buy a piano right away?
A.2 No. I recommend the rental piano.

Q.3 Do you offer any discounts?
A.3 We offer no discount.

Q.4 Are their specific start times for new students?
A.4 No. New students can start anytime of the year.

Q.5 How long and how frequent are the lessons?
A.5 The standard lesson is 30 minutes. 60 minute lessons are recommended for accelerated learning.
